Description[edit]
The first new post–Clan Invasion aerospace fighter developed in the Draconis Combine, the Oni is a heavily armored medium-ranged craft.
The desperation of the Clan invasion years forced the Combine to quickly upgrade its forces. After the production site of Combine's pride and joy, the new-tech Sai, was captured by Clan Smoke Jaguar, they focused primarily upon fielding advanced refits of its existing venerable designs. With fighter design lagging behind new BattleMechs, it was only after the development of the Omni-Conversion S-7 model of the Sai and the Tatsu OmniFighters that Wakazashi could look towards developing a new non-OmniFighter. However their efforts were delayed yet further thanks to the FedCom Civil War and Combine-Ghost Bear War, and as such the Oni didn't make its first flight until 3066.
Slightly less maneuverable than its lighter sibling because its use of a heavier but less costly standard Shinobi 275-rated fusion engine, the Oni has a similar level of armor protection with six tons of advanced Chatham "Bakemono" ferro-aluminum plating and superior heat dissipation thanks to its 13 double heat sinks. The Oni has been well received by the DCMS, who appreciate its combination of resilience and hard-hitting firepower. Only its poor endurance has drawn criticism, though this merely limits the missions appropriate to the design.[4]
Weapons and Equipment[edit]
Building upon the S-7 Sai's loadout, the Oni carries a nose-mounted Shigunga MRM-30 capable unleashing a withering volume of fire at medium range, supported by a Diverse Optics Sunbeam ER small laser. The remaining longer ranged weapons consist of a pair of Diverse Optics Type 30X ER large lasers mounted one per wings. Two tons of missile reloads is more than adequate given the fuel-capacity and combat range of the fighter.[4]
Variants[edit]
- ON-2
- This version of the Oni is equipped with a nose-mounted MRM-40 with an Apollo FCS, while each wing carries a trio of ER medium lasers. A Guardian ECM suite is also fitted to disrupt enemy communications and targeting networks. BV (2.0) = 1,597[5]
- ON-2X
- A Jihad-era variant which utilizes experimental technology by Wakazashi Enterprises. The Combine's leaders used stolen Capellan technology acquired through the Blakists to give the Oni eight and half tons of vehicular stealth armor. To make the armor's stealth capacity function, engineers led by Russell Honda added the experimental Angel ECM suite. Its MRM-30 launcher has been fitted with an Apollo Fire Control System, allowing the normally unguided weapons to hit with more accuracy. The craft's two ER large lasers have been swapped out for a nose-mounted Binary Laser Cannon, the wing lasers have been replaced with ER medium lasers, and the aft is a protected by a medium pulse laser. To increase the craft's survivability against missile attacks, an experimental Laser AMS is mounted in the nose alongside the weapons there. For pilots to adjust their additional energy weapons fire, engineers increased the number of double heat sinks mounted to 15. BV (1.0) = ????, BV (2.0) = 1,733[6]
Notes[edit]
- Oni ("鬼おに") means demon in Japanese.
